Oh God. Fall Out Boy is Back.

Fall Out Boy

Music in 2013 is getting weird, guys. First, Beyonce launched her return to world domination with a Destiny’s Child reunion and their less-than-fab new single “Nuclear” (though they really rocked the hairography at the Super Bowl last Sunday). Then Justin Timberlake promised to bring his “sexy back,” but confused us all by choosing “Suit and Tie” as his first single. (Good song, but really Justin, that’s your lead move here?)

Now Fall Out Boy, those Wilmette wonders who took emo and eyeliner mainstream, are back. They released a new single, “My Songs Know What You Did In The Dark (Light Em Up).” The track shot to the number 2 spot on the iTunes chart and the boys played to a sold out audience at Subterranean last night, all with barely any notice of a reunion.

That’s not all. Their new album, Save Rock and Roll, is out May 7. They’re playing Jimmy Kimmel Live next week, and prepping for a tour this summer (Chicago fans: they’re playing the Riviera May 16).

We’ve already talked about how this year is 2006 all over again. Now the Best New Artist from 2006 is back on tour?

Just don’t give us James Blunt again, 2013. That’s all we ask.
